What the Zoom connection does

Connecting Zoom lets Chief automatically sync your meeting transcripts and chat logs from Zoom, so that material comes into Chief without manual uploads.

Connect Zoom

  1. Go to SettingsIntegrations.
  2. Find the Zoom card — “Automatically sync meeting transcripts and chat logs from Zoom.”
  3. Click Connect next to Zoom.
⚠️ Important: Integrations are available to paying users. If you’re signed out, you’ll be asked to sign up first; if you’re signed in, clicking Connect opens a “Book a Call” prompt to set the integration up with the Chief team rather than a one-click self-serve connection.

Zoom sync vs. a Live Session

These are two different paths to the same goal:
  • A Live Session captures a meeting live through the Chief desktop app on your Mac.
  • The Zoom integration pulls transcripts and chat logs that Zoom itself produced.
